Descripción general
Choline chloride-trimethyl-d9 is an isotopic analogue of Choline chloride.
Aplicación
Choline chloride-trimethyl-d9 can be used in the determination of betaines by fast atom bombardment mass spectrometry.It is also used to study the nanostructure and hydration of deep eutectic solvent.
